Fiction Beer Company

Why Fiction Beer Company is a fun option when searching for things to do near me with friends and family
Fiction Beer Company offers a unique and welcoming space in Denver's Park Hill neighborhood, combining a love of craft beer with a passion for literature. Founded in 2014 as Denver’s first brewery on Colfax Avenue, Fiction Beer has grown into a cherished community hub renowned for its imaginative beers and cozy atmosphere. This brewery invites guests to relax in a taproom adorned with bookshelves, enjoy a wide range of creatively named brews inspired by literary themes, and savor time with friends on the heated patio featuring personal domes and tents. The venue is dog-friendly on the patio, encouraging a casual, inclusive experience for all visitors. Besides its impressive lineup of craft beers, Fiction Beer Company supports local food trucks, like Cajun-gourmet Sauvage and the Pie Queen, complementing the vibrant beer offerings. The brewery hosts popular weekly trivia nights and special events like live music and patio games, making it a lively and engaging place to gather. Visitors can also purchase beer to go, including growlers and bombers, as well as branded merchandise such as glassware, shirts, and baby wear, further connecting patrons to the Fiction Beer community. The recent reopening under passionate new owners who brew beer themselves continues to honor the legacy while expanding its creativity, ensuring Fiction Beer Company remains a standout destination for both beer aficionados and book lovers alike.

What food and drink options are available for large groups? Although Fiction Beer Company doesn’t have an in-house kitchen, it provides excellent food flexibility, which is a strong asset for groups with varied tastes. Visitors are welcome to bring their own food or have meals delivered from nearby restaurants, accommodating dietary preferences and convenience. Additionally, from Thursday through Sunday, local food trucks regularly provide diverse culinary options directly on-site, ranging from gourmet snacks to substantial meals—perfect for enhancing your brewery visit. On the drink side, besides their acclaimed craft beers, the brewery offers non-alcoholic beverages and slush beers that appeal to a broader range of guests, including those who prefer lighter or alcohol-free drinks. For groups wanting to take the experience home or extend their enjoyment, beer to go is available in bombers and growlers. What makes the beer at Fiction Beer Company special for groups? Fiction Beer Company is lauded for offering a creative, award-winning lineup of beers that transform each visit into a tasting adventure for groups. Their brews are inspired by literature, with each beer style reflecting a story or character—from amber wheat lagers inspired by Winnie the Pooh to innovative new releases like Scottish ales or blood orange cream ales. This imaginative approach encourages group members to explore uniquely named flavors and share tasting notes, organically creating a social and interactive atmosphere. The brewery’s commitment to quality has been recognized with medals at prestigious competitions such as the Great American Beer Festival and the World Beer Cup, underscoring the excellence behind their stories.
